OXFORD: Adam Hitchcox and Stuart Walford, technicians at BMW dealer North Oxford Garage, based on the Wolvercote roundabout, have become part of a groundbreaking nationwide move to raise standards of car servicing and repair.

They have both passed their BMW technician assessment, which also qualifies them as Accredited Technicians in a new scheme run by the Institute of the Motor Industry.

The scheme included a series of practical tests and an online knowledge test. They must be reassessed after five years to maintain their credentials.

Graham Livesey, of North Oxford Garage, said: "Vehicles are becoming increasingly sophisticated and complex, so it's vital that there is a recognised benchmark of technical competence."
